The small Church in the settlement of Parsata is dedicated to Panagia Odigitria

Chapels in Cyprus - Panagia Odigitria, Parsata, Ora, Mountainous Larnaca, Larnaca

In the abandoned settlement of Parsata found in the periphery of the village of Ora in the mountain area of Larnaca, there is a small Church dedicated to Panagia Odigitria (Our Lady the Guide).

Parsata, the abandoned settlement on the periphery of the village of Ora

Villages in Cyprus - Settlements - Parsata, Ora, Mountainous Larnaca, Larnaca

Parsata is another abandoned “village” of Cyprus. It is only 3 kilometres east of the village of Lagia and 5 kilometres northwest of the also abandoned “village” of Drapia. The Holy Church of Archangel Michael in the village of Oroklini in Larnaca

Church of Cyprus - Archangel Michael, Oroklini, Old Church, Larnaca

In the village of Oroklini, in the district of Larnaca is where the Church dedicated to Archangel Michael is found. It is a construction dated in the 17th century. The small Church was the main church of the settlers of the community, until another, bigger one was built.

The Holy Church of Archangel Michael in Oroklini, Larnaca is impressive

Church of Cyprus - Archangel Michael, Oroklini, New Church, Larnaca

The new Church dedicated to Archangel Michael is found at a small distance from the old Church which is also dedicated to the Archangel. It is a Church of Byzantine school, it is cruciform and has a dome.
